Kate Henshaw Opens Up on Drift From Genevieve Nnaji, Says I Don’t Know What Came Over Her
Veteran Nollywood actress Kate Henshaw has broken her silence on the gradual breakdown of her once-close friendship with fellow screen icon, Genevieve Nnaji, admitting she still cannot fully explain what caused the distance between them.
Speaking on the Tea with Tay podcast, the 53-year-old actress reflected candidly on a bond that quietly dissolved despite years of shared history, public appearances, and mutual professional regard.
Henshaw said the two were once inseparable, regularly attending events together during the early years of Netflix’s operations in Nigeria, before a noticeable gap began to emerge.
She suggested that Nnaji may have developed some form of mistrust towards her, though she stopped short of stating anything definitive, acknowledging that she remains in the dark about the root cause. “We grew apart. Maybe she had some kind of mistrust about me. I don’t know what happened. I don’t know what came over her,” she said.
The disclosure adds to a conversation Henshaw began in a 2024 interview with media personality Chude Jideonwo, where she spoke about Nnaji’s characteristically reserved nature and how it could leave those around her second-guessing themselves.
At the time, Henshaw recalled a period when she felt uncertain about where she stood with her colleague, before a film shoot helped her understand that Nnaji’s withdrawal was not directed at her personally. The two have since shared at least one professional encounter, reuniting on set for a Netflix advertisement filmed in South Africa.
Henshaw was careful to frame the estrangement without bitterness, noting that friendships do not always endure and that people remain in each other’s lives for varying reasons and seasons. Her remarks have nonetheless struck a chord with fans who grew accustomed to seeing the two actresses as close allies during Nollywood’s golden era, with many taking to social media to share their reactions, some defending Nnaji’s well-known preference for privacy while others expressed nostalgia for the friendship.
Genevieve Nnaji, who has maintained a largely low public profile in recent years, has not responded to Henshaw’s comments.
